What the White Card actually is
The White Memory card is a nationally steady abilities for building induction instruction. In Western Australia, it aligns with device of capability CPCWHS1001, Prepare to work safely and securely in the building sector. You earn it with a Registered Instruction Organisation, at that point you receive either a bodily memory card or an electronic proof depending upon the carrier's method. When released, it performs certainly not run out, although a lot of employers are going to request for a refresher course if you have actually certainly not operated in construction for a stretch, frequently 2 years or more. If you shed the card, the RTO that released it may reissue a replacement, which normally takes a few business times and a fee.
The factor is actually basic. Development is actually an atmosphere where reduced chance threats possess high repercussions. One bad lift can subsidiary you for months. A missing shield can easily change a life in a second. The White Memory card makes certain that before you step onto a website in Perth, you discuss a standard lexicon as well as a collection of essential exercise with everyone else on that piece, platform, or trench.

Can you complete it online in Western side Australia
The quick answer is actually no for WA residents. Western Australia needs direct delivery for CPCWHS1001, or even at most virtual distribution with real-time interaction that satisfies WA's criteria for identity inspections as well as assessment stability. Over the years, individuals have tried to avoid this by enlisting with interstate RTOs that provide pure on-line training courses. That can backfire. Numerous WA sites are going to not accept an internet certificate if you are resident in WA or working in WA, and auditors can easily invalidate the memory card if it was actually not released under the right jurisdictional rules.
If you are actually located in Perth, book an in person training class along with a compliant RTO. It takes a couple of hrs extra out of your time than an easy on-line questions, however it stays away from migraines later on when a site administrator declines you at the gate.
What to assume in the course of a Perth White Card Course
Most Perth carriers operate the training course over a single time, generally 6 to 8 hrs, featuring breaks. Some push to a half day for seasoned workers, but the common design is actually an early morning of organized material and also conversation, at that point an afternoon covering practical demonstrations and assessment.
The instructor starts along with the lawful platform and also obligation of treatment. They deal with obligations under WA's Job Health and Safety laws, appointment on internet site, as well as the part of Safe Work Strategy Statements. Great trainers keep this grounded. They are going to mount the rule in examples you can visualize, like modifying a saw blade without segregating the resource or even functioning around a mobile crane swing radius with vague omission zones.
The middle of the day normally dives into primary danger classifications. Assume to resolve true events coming from Perth and also regional WA work, certainly not theoretical scenarios. Troughs that fell down considering that benching was missed. An eye personal injury coming from a grinder along with a removed shield. A near-miss on a rooftop when a weak window went undetected under dirt. Instructors who have actually focused on web sites in Kwinana, Osborne Park, or even the Pilbara bring stories that stick.
By the mid-day, you will definitely cover emergency situation response, disclosing, and the fundamentals of emergency treatment and also event communication. Not a total first aid cert, but sufficient to recognize just how to switch on a web site program, that to get in touch with, as well as what certainly not to accomplish while expecting support. You will definitely likewise perform or at the very least illustrate secure installation of PPE and also standard risk examination strategies. At that point you rest the evaluation, which mixes created inquiries along with oral checks and practical tasks, depending on the provider.
What the analysis looks like
Assessment formats vary, however they all map back to CPCWHS1001. You should prepare to check out and interpret a safety sign, identify a hazard coming from a photo or scenario, clarify just how you would certainly minimize the danger, and also choose necessary PPE. A Lot Of RTOs in Perth feature a brief knowledge test, normally 20 to 40 questions, as well as a useful element where you illustrate risk controls. If English is not your mother tongue, say to the RTO in advance. They can typically supply realistic adjustments, such as checking out inquiries out loud or even making clear the intent without giving away answers.
Trainers are actually not making an effort to mislead you. They want to view that you understand, for example, why a harness without a suited support is pointless or even why making use of a smart phone in a designated no-phone region may be dangerous around moving vegetation. They check that you can easily detect an improvement in conditions and also recognize exactly how to rise it through an administrator or even permit system.

How the White Card suits with various other training
The White Memory card is actually a base, not an alternative, for task-specific tickets. If you are operating a boom-type EWP over 11 metres, you need the risky job permit. If you are slinging lots, haunting and also furnishing tickets administer. If you are actually reducing concrete, a quick training program on silica dirt controls and artificial lung suit testing is actually clever as well as considerably necessary on bigger sites. Several brand new workers conflate the White Memory card with these competencies. They are different layers. The White Memory card offers you the foreign language as well as the logic to undertake any sort of activity carefully. Your various other tickets confirm you can carry out certain tasks within that framework.
In Perth, I see more web sites requesting proof of respirator match screening, silica understanding training, asbestos understanding for demonstration work, and verification of capability on usual plant. Have your documents coordinated. Always keep digital duplicates all set to send to a site induction organizer. If you are actually freelance, create an easy folder on your phone along with PDFs. It spares time at the gate and also prevents uncomfortable calls back to the office.

The protection basics you will take another look at, as well as why they still matter
PPE is actually certainly not a silver bullet. It sits at the end of the pecking order of commands, and also the course will definitely make that clear. Yet PPE is the best noticeable day-to-day practice, and it needs to have to be done right. Gloves that correct for one job may be wrong for one more. Cut-resistant handwear covers around spinning devices could be a risk. The lesson deals with that distinction. Hard hats need to have substitute after influence or noticeable damage. Reflective vests aid around moving plant at sunrise or dusk when exposure drops, especially on wintertime times near the waterway when fog rolls in.
Manual managing is actually yet another subject matter folks presume they understand actually. The training program will certainly press beyond the outdated "flex your knees" concept. It takes a look at planning lifts, using help like trolleys, and restoring operations thus hefty items are kept at waistline height through default. I have checked out teams reduced their back grievances through relocating a pallet decline 5 metres nearer relevant of use and insisting that rubbish bypasses sit no greater than breast level.
Working at heights acquires careful interest. Guardrails beat harnesses whenever achievable. Support factors need to have confirmation, certainly not guesswork. On roofings, fragile pieces, skylights, and also corrugated edges are actually deadlies. The training course delivers the state of mind to talk to, Possesses anybody formally examined this anchor? Are our company counting on a structural element that is not measured? It provides you the questions that maintain you alive.
Electrical safety stays a staple. Transportable RCDs, exam and tag, and the fundamentals of isolating equipment come up a whole lot. In useful conditions, regularly inspect that an electrical power panel has actually RCD security and that cords are directed away from water and web traffic. Cease if you find an overlooking guard or fractured channel. Those 5 minutes devoted mentioning a danger are actually less expensive than a life-time of clarifying an injury.

When the White Card is not enough
The White Memory https://caidenbncc127.lucialpiazzale.com/perth-white-card-course-criteria-costs-and-also-timeframe card provides you baseline expertise, but some worksites or even customers level additional demands. A refinery, as an example, might mandate site-specific inductions, permit-to-work units, and also additional proficiencies before you may enter specific regions. Huge framework ventures often require task inductions that consist of distinct techniques and interaction guidelines. Carry out certainly not think the White Memory card clears you for every thing. Manage it as a ticket, after that accumulate visas in the form of site inductions and also duty tickets.
In residential as well as small business work, the main extra criteria is typically an in depth site induction along with the contractor, where you examine the SWMS for your extent and also settle on controls for mutual risks like get access to, home cleaning, and temporary energy. Maintain your documentation constant. If your SWMS is actually clear and also to the point, administrators answer a lot better. Clearness gets trust.
What it seems like on your 1st day with a brand-new card
You will definitely arrive early. There will definitely be actually a website induction before you touch everything. The induction covers the policies of that website: muster points, conveniences, smoking cigarettes locations, to begin with aiders, and emergency get in touches with. You will sign a pile of papers, consisting of acknowledgment of the website guidelines and your SWMS. Someone will inspect your White Memory card particulars. Often they take an image for their body. They issue an internet site gain access to sticker label or even card.
Walk the web site along with your eyes up. Take note the plant paths, pedestrian courses, as well as exemption regions. Inspect the weather as well as any sort of wind advisories, especially if you are lifting, scaffold, or operating at elevation. Ask where the MSDS or SDS directories are. Validate how to disclose a threat or even event. Launch your own self to the leading hand and the very first aider. If you can, stroll your workspace just before you offload the ute. I have enjoyed more near-misses happen in the very first 10 moments than in the next ten hrs, merely considering that people focused on starting prompt instead of starting safe.
